ip地址对应域名查询
在互联网的庞大体系中,IP地址和域名是两个核心概念,它们共同构成了网络通信的基础,IP地址是设备在网络中的唯一标识,由一串数字组成(如192.168.1.1),而域名则是人类易于记忆的地址(如www.example.com),当用户通过域名访问网站时,系统需要通过一种机制将域名转换为对应的IP地址,这一过程便是“IP地址对应域名查询”,也常被称为“反向DNS查询”或“PTR记录查询”,本文将详细介绍IP地址对应域名查询的原理、方法、应用场景及注意事项,帮助读者全面理解这一技术过程。

IP地址对应域名查询的原理
IP地址对应域名查询与常见的域名解析(正向DNS查询)方向相反,正向DNS查询是将域名转换为IP地址,而反向DNS查询则是将IP地址映射回对应的域名,这一过程依赖于DNS系统中的PTR(Pointer Record)记录,PTR记录是反向DNS区域文件中的一种资源记录,用于将IP地址与域名关联。
反向DNS查询的工作流程如下:
- 查询发起:当用户或系统需要查询某个IP地址对应的域名时,会向DNS服务器发送反向查询请求。
- 反向解析区域:DNS服务器首先检查该IP地址所属的反向解析区域,IP地址192.0.2.1的反向解析区域为1.2.0.192.in-addr.arpa。
- PTR记录查找:DNS服务器在反向解析区域中查找与IP地址对应的PTR记录。
- 返回结果:如果找到PTR记录,DNS服务器将返回关联的域名;若未找到,则查询失败。
需要注意的是,反向DNS查询并非所有IP地址都支持,它需要IP地址的拥有者(如ISP或企业)在DNS服务器中正确配置PTR记录。
IP地址对应域名查询的常用方法
用户可以通过多种工具和方法进行IP地址对应域名查询,以下为几种常见方式:
使用命令行工具
-
nslookup:这是最常用的DNS查询工具之一,在命令行中输入
nslookup IP地址,即可查看该IP地址对应的域名。nslookup 8.8.8.8输出结果可能为
dns.google,表明8.8.8.8是Google的DNS服务器。 -
dig:
dig是另一个强大的DNS查询工具,功能比nslookup更全面,使用方法为:dig -x IP地址dig -x 1.1.1.1将返回Cloudflare的域名信息。
-
host:
host命令是Linux和macOS系统中的轻量级DNS查询工具,语法简单:host IP地址
在线查询工具
对于不熟悉命令行的用户,可以通过在线DNS查询工具完成反向查询。
- DNSChecker.org:提供正向和反向DNS查询服务,只需输入IP地址即可。
- MXToolbox:支持多种DNS查询功能,包括反向查询,并附带详细的诊断信息。
专业网络管理工具
在网络管理中,工具如Wireshark和Nmap也支持反向DNS查询功能,Nmap在扫描网络时会自动尝试对发现的IP地址进行反向解析,以便更直观地显示设备信息。
IP地址对应域名查询的应用场景
反向DNS查询在多个领域具有重要应用价值,以下是几个典型场景:
邮件服务器验证
邮件服务器在接收邮件时,会通过反向DNS查询检查发件人IP地址的域名是否与发件人声称的域名一致,这有助于防止垃圾邮件和钓鱼攻击,因为大多数垃圾邮件发送者不会配置正确的PTR记录。
网络故障排查
当网络出现连接问题时,管理员可以通过反向DNS查询确认IP地址是否属于已知的服务器或设备,如果某个IP地址的域名与预期不符,可能表明网络配置存在异常或设备被非法占用。
安全审计与日志分析
在安全审计中,反向DNS查询可以帮助分析师将IP地址转换为更具可读性的域名,从而快速识别恶意活动来源,在防火墙日志中发现可疑IP地址后,通过反向查询可判断其是否属于已知威胁组织。
内容分发网络(CDN)管理
CDN服务商通过反向DNS查询可以管理全球节点的IP地址分配,确保用户请求能够正确路由到最近的缓存服务器。

IP地址对应域名查询的注意事项
尽管反向DNS查询功能强大,但在实际应用中需注意以下几点:
PTR记录的配置要求
并非所有IP地址都支持反向查询,只有IP地址的拥有者(如ISP或云服务商)才能配置PTR记录,且需要确保记录的准确性和唯一性,企业自建的服务器需要联系网络管理员添加PTR记录。
查询结果的延迟
反向DNS查询可能存在一定的延迟,尤其是当DNS服务器配置不当或网络拥塞时,在需要实时响应的场景中(如高频安全监控),建议结合其他技术手段。
隐私与安全性
反向DNS查询可能暴露网络拓扑信息,例如服务器的真实域名或地理位置,敏感环境下的IP地址应谨慎配置PTR记录,避免泄露关键信息。
工具的局限性
部分工具可能无法正确解析某些特殊格式的IP地址(如IPv6地址),或因DNS服务器的限制返回错误结果,建议尝试多种工具交叉验证。
IP地址对应域名查询是DNS系统的重要功能之一,它在邮件安全、网络管理、安全审计等领域发挥着不可替代的作用,通过理解其工作原理、掌握常用查询方法,并合理应用在实际场景中,用户可以更高效地解决网络问题、提升系统安全性,需要注意的是,反向DNS查询的有效性依赖于正确的PTR记录配置,因此在实际操作中需结合具体需求进行规划和优化,随着互联网技术的不断发展,反向DNS查询仍将在网络通信中扮演关键角色,为用户提供更智能、更安全的网络服务体验。




















